Version 1.1 Release (June 20, 2007)

  • Updated HTML editor that includes a full-screen option, html formatting, media embedding (flash, quicktime, windows media), and speed improvements
  • 'Name' and 'Title' carries over to Menu Items and Pages
  • 'Stand-alone pages' (you can choose for a page to not show in the menu)
  • Shortened Announcement box, but expanded the amount of text that shows
  • Session time-out increased to 1 hour
  • 'Other Affiliations' show on faculty homepages
  • Easier Landing-page management
  • Improved photo, title, address format on faculty and researcher homepages

CMS Updates and Enhancements 

  • Added stand alone page publishing which allows users to create pages that are unassociated with menu or submenu items.  The pages would be linked to from content pieces on other pages. (May 10, 2007)
  • Enhanced landing page (about HSPH, Research, Faculty ...) management (May 10, 2007)
  • Added WYWIWYG editor to Contact Us triage form to allow for formatted message, web links, and email addresses without requiring HTML code (May 10, 2007)
  • Publishing timeouts increased to 45 minutes (from 20 minutes) and locks were adjusted to 1 hour (from 24 hours) (May 9, 2007)
  • Added administration of Global Research Projects for faculty member as a MODULE (April 9, 2007)

Bug Fixes

  • Resolved formatting issue with IE6 on faculty and researcher pages with name, title and department information only (May 10, 2007)
Known Bugs
  • CMS does not fully work on Safari for MAC.  MAC users need to use Safari until a new AJAX library is tested and implemented on the CMS.
